In many countries today, laws protect wildlife. In India the need for such protection was realized centuries ago.
About 300 BC, an Indian writer described that forests were like national parks today. The game of killing beasts was carefully supervised. Some animals were fully protected, nobody was allowed to cut down timber, bum wood for charcoal, or trap animals for their furs. Animals that became dangerous to human visitors were trapped or killed outside the park, so that other animals would not become uneasy.
The need for wildlife protection is greater now than ever before. About a thousand species of animals are in danger of dying out, and the rate at which they are being destroyed has increased. With mammals, for example, the rate of extinction, is about one species every year. From AD 1 to 1800, the rate was about one species every fifty years. Everywhere men are trying to solve the problem of preserving wildlife while caring for the world’s growing population.
